Valve's MOBA Shooter Deadlock Apparently Has Another, Even More Exclusive Build

Valve's MOBA hero shooter, Deadlock, remains in an invite-only testing phase, with the company diligently refining and enhancing the game. However, a recent livestream mishap may have inadvertently disclosed the existence of a second, even more exclusive playtest, featuring previously unseen characters and redesigns.

The leak originated from a livestream hosted by a prominent Deadlock player, who reportedly opened the wrong Deadlock build during the stream, as reported by Eurogamer. The footage, captured by viewers, revealed several new characters such as the retro-styled Doorman, the bespectacled Bookworm, and the gothic Vampirebat, along with visual updates to existing characters like Ivy. Although the streamer quickly corrected their mistake, the information had already spread.

PlayAs of now, no further details have emerged from this fresh leak. Deadlock has a history of leaks, with its very existence and content previously surfacing through various channels. While test builds for larger groups of players to experiment with upcoming updates are not uncommon, it's intriguing for a game like Deadlock, which is still in its early, invite-only stage.

Reactions on the r/DeadlockTheGame subreddit are varied, with some players expressing frustration at feeling excluded from what they thought was already an exclusive playtest. Deadlock's more public build has seen numerous changes, including the removal of an entire lane. Valve has previously utilized the Hero Labs mode to allow players to test new heroes, but this new development suggests an additional, highly selective testing method.

Despite its invite-only status, Deadlock has attracted a significant player base and garnered attention from fans of both shooter games and MOBAs. A new game from Valve naturally draws interest, but the unique rollout and continued exclusivity have only heightened its allure. The revelation of an even more exclusive build adds another layer of intrigue for players to ponder.
